Around the clock

Bryan and his team manage water coming in and out of the water treatment plant around the clock. They work with water treatment chemicals, lab staff, water quality staff and other departments to produce safe drinking water to meet customer demand. It’s a job that requires a lot of autonomy since you often work alone. And it’s a job that can keep you on your toes.
“There’s no typical day in the water treatment world, you have to be able to adapt to new challenges because the public health of 1.4 million customers is on the line.” Bryan said. Bryan loves supervising because it allows him to teach others.
